Bring back a dead thread... I know it appears work has been paused here, but does anyone know why? Yes, I know the park has been closed for months. But typically, large corporations have money already earmarked for a project before starting it---after all, work on Nintendo seems to be proceeding, and they were able to finish construction on the Sports Grill during the pandemic.

And I'm sure under COVID, Citywalk has a better chance of reopening first before the park does, so it'd be good for them to have a draw until the park opens (or are they just counting on Sports Grill as the new draw?). Plus, the cost for it has to be nearly incidental compared to Nintendo.

Even if LA just reopens outdoor dinning, they could be selling from a To Go window with the seating they had put up near the movie theater (especially while Sports Grill still sits closed in outdoor dining because it doesn't have that much outdoor space, and what little it has is being used by Antojitos as needed). So even more reason they could be working on it.

Anyone have any insights?
